Comprehending Environmental Contamination

Pollution stands as a major most significant threats to our environment and health. It occurs when dangerous substances or contaminants are released into multiple ecosystems, leading to deterioration of air, water, and soil. From manufacturing emissions to plastic waste, the manifestations of pollution are widespread and often covert. Urban areas, especially, face chronic air quality concerns, impacting the health of millions of people. The effects of pollution can be instant, as evident in smoggy days, or chronic, through long-lasting health problems and ecological disruption.

The origins of environmental contamination can be classified into several types, including single source and diffuse pollution. Single source pollution refers to pollutants that enter the environment from a definite, identifiable source, such as a factory or wastewater facility. In contrast, diffuse pollution is more scattered, arising from various sources such as agricultural runoff or urban stormwater. https://elpastorcitosb.com/ The struggle of dealing with non-point sources lies in their pervasive nature, making it hard to identify exact sources and implement regulations effectively.

Actions to address environmental contamination require cooperation across neighborhoods, governments, and businesses. Legislative measures like the Air Quality Improvement Act aim to set standards for air quality, while advancements in technology advancing cleaner manufacturing practices. Public awareness campaigns also play a crucial role in educating individuals about lowering their carbon footprint and participating in eco-friendly practices. By understanding the complexities of pollution, we can take educated steps towards a healthier planet for coming generations.

Impact of Natural Disasters

Nature’s disasters have profound and far-reaching impacts on the natural world, contributing to pollution and habitat destruction. Events such as hurricanes, forest fires, and deluges can devastate ecosystems, leading to the loss of variety of species. When these disasters occur, the prompt aftermath often includes the emission of harmful substances into the air and water, worsening pollution levels and posing significant health threats to nearby communities.

The increasing frequency of natural disasters, often linked to climate change, highlights the critical need for conservation efforts. As heat rise and weather patterns shift, regions once considered secure are now at risk of tectonic movements, floods, and other calamities. These changes not only disrupt human life but also threaten the delicate balance of ecosystems, which can be irreparably damaged by such events.

In addition, the financial costs associated with natural disasters compound the environmental damage. Recovery efforts often prioritize rebuilding infrastructure over ecological restoration. This narrow-minded approach can lead to the additional degradation of natural habitats and an increase in pollution, as communities rebuild with little regard for environmental stewardship. To ensure the preservation of our planet, it is essential to incorporate conservation strategies into disaster response and recovery operations.

Getting Ready for Future Earthquakes

As the occurrence of environmental disasters including earthquakes continues to grow, communities must emphasize preparedness to secure lives and property. This begins with education and awareness; individuals and families should be aware about the dangers associated with earthquakes and understand the necessity of having an emergency plan in place. Schools and organizations can play a crucial role by providing instruction on earthquake drills and safety measures, ensuring that everyone understands how to react when the ground starts to shake.

Building design and infrastructure also hold a vital role in earthquake preparedness. Governments and local authorities need to strengthen and revise building codes that require structures to withstand seismic activity. Retrofitting historic buildings can significantly reduce the risk of collapse during an earthquake, while new constructions should incorporate modern engineering practices that increase safety. Furthermore, urban planning must consider the risks of earthquakes, thoughtfully locating essential services like hospitals and fire stations in areas that limit potential disaster losses.

In addition to structural improvements, communities should cultivate a culture of resilience by promoting collaboration among residents, government agencies, and emergency services. Regular community drills and awareness campaigns can emphasize the importance of being prepared. Additionally, developing a network of support systems, including emergency response teams and communication plans, will boost the community’s ability to respond promptly and effectively when an earthquake strikes. The goal is to create a well-informed public that can handle the uncertainties of earthquakes, ultimately reducing the impact of these natural disasters on human life and the environment.
